Released in 1958, The Flower in Hell is a drama and crime film directed by Shin Sang-ok, running about 88 minutes.
What it’s about. In post-Korean War Seoul, a young man from the countryside discovers that his older brother has become romantically involved in a prostitute and has no intentions of returning home.
Who’s in it. The Flower in Hell stars Choi Eun-hee as Sonia, Hak Kim as Young-shik, Hae-won Jo as Dong-shik and Seon-hui Gang as Judy, among others.
